Grounded Solutions Network’s Inclusionary Housing Database Map is an interactive tool that includes data from two surveys: 1) a national census of local inclusionary housing programs that was conducted in 2016 by Grounded Solutions Network and was updated thereafter, and 2) a national survey of state-level ...
